World Village Festival this weekend in the center of Helsinki

World Village Festival, dedicated to sustainable development, will be held  this weekend May 16–17 in Helsinki’s Lasipalatsi District and at Narinkka Square. The programme features music, talks, exhibitors, and activities for children. The theme of the admission free festival is Freedom.

– World Village Festival is returning to central Helsinki, and everything looks great at the new venue. When planning your visit to the festival, it’s a good idea to check out the various indoor and outdoor spaces so you don’t miss any part of the event. Nearly 90 exhibitor stands and over 60 programmes offer a wide variety of interesting things to see and experience. Since the area is smaller than before, there will be no food vendors this year. Instead, there are dozens of restaurants around the area offering a variety of delicacies, which are worth visiting to recharge in the midst of the festival buzz, says the festival’s communications manager Nelli Korpi.

The concert programme includes French Colombian singer-bassist Ëda Diaz, a pioneer of Congolese electronic musicKizaba and psychedelic desert rock band Jamila & The Other Heroes. Among the Finnish artists, the programme will feature Emilia Sisco Sextet, Vodou Fusion, Yona, Aizhan Sultan, the children’s music group Mutaveijarit and Jarmo Saari Republic with Freedom Speeches concert.

The theme of Freedom is featured extensively, for example on the Speaker’s Stage in Bio Rex. The programme features perspectives on Freedom from various crisis-stricken regions, as well as discussions on the rights of young people and children, the state of democracy, and digital freedom.

The programme also includes adult’s workshops and children’s activities at Luckan, Peace & Sports area for young people, Funky Amigos’ terrace party, and nearly 90 exhibitors at Narinkka Square, Mauno Koivisto Square, and Bio Rex.

At the Kamppi Chapel, the festival weekend will feature panel discussions, workshops, yoga, music, and a chance to unwind amid the festival buzz. At Rosebud’s Book World, there will be a stage dedicated to literature-focused discussions.

World Village Festival is Finland’s leading event for global action for the whole family, an admission free cultural festival, and a trade fair for sustainable development. The event will be organised in the Centre on Helsinki, Lasipalatsi District and Narinkka Square 16–17 May 2026 with Freedom as its theme. The festival is expected to attract 25,000 to 30,000 visitors. The festival’s core values are diversity, inspiration, equality, responsibility, and community spirit. Organised by Finnish Development NGOs Fingo, the main partners are the European Commission Representation in Finland and the European Parliament Liaison Office in Finland, Finn Church Aid and Maailman Kuvalehti magazine
